log_error
选项,该选项指定了错误日志的存储位置。,2. 使用命令行工具,登录到MySQL服务器,执行以下SQL查询:,,“sql,SHOW VARIABLES LIKE 'log_error';,
“,,这将返回错误日志文件的路径。在数据库管理与运维过程中,查看错误日志是一项非常重要的技能,MySQL数据库提供了多种类型的日志,其中就包括了错误日志,这个日志记录了MySQL启动、运行或停止过程中出现的错误信息,对于排查数据库故障提供了关键线索,下面将解析如何在MySQL中查询数据库错误日志的过程:
1、错误日志的重要性
错误日志记录了MySQL服务器运行过程中遇到的所有错误信息,通过查看错误日志,可以快速定位数据库异常,如启动失败、运行时错误等情况。
2、查看错误日志的位置
要查找错误日志,可以通过MySQL命令行工具执行命令SHOW VARIABLES LIKE 'log_error';
,该命令会返回当前设置的错误日志文件的完整路径。
3、解读错误日志内容
错误日志包含了错误发生的时间、错误等级和具体的错误信息,这些信息有助于管理员进行问题诊断和后续的修复工作。
4、通用查询日志的作用
虽然主要讲的是错误日志,但不得不提的是通用查询日志,它记录所有的查询操作,包括对数据的增删改查操作,开启它会对性能有一定影响,因此通常在生产环境中是关闭的,但在开发和调试阶段非常有帮助。
5、慢查询日志的特点
慢查询日志专门记录执行时间过长的查询,这有助于优化数据库性能,通过分析慢查询日志,可以找到需要优化的SQL语句。
6、二进制日志的应用
二进制日志记录了所有更改数据的查询,主要用于数据复制和恢复,通过工具mysqlbinlog
可以查看二进制日志的内容。
在运用上述方法查询数据库错误日志时,也要注意以下几点:
确认日志功能是否启用,在查看日志之前,应先检查相关日志功能是否已在MySQL配置文件中启用。
适时地清理日志,定期清理旧的日志文件可以避免日志文件占用过多磁盘空间,从而影响系统性能。
了解如何查询和利用MySQL数据库错误日志是数据库管理员的重要技能,通过上述步骤,可以有效地查看并分析错误日志,进而解决数据库运行中出现的问题,掌握通用查询日志和慢查询日志的使用,也会在数据库性能优化和故障排查中发挥重要作用,接下来将通过一些常见问题进一步阐释相关操作:
FAQs
Q1: 如何开启MySQL的通用查询日志?
Q2: 如果我只想查看特定类型的错误日志,应该如何操作?
针对这两个问题,首先需要修改MySQL配置文件(my.cnf或my.ini),在其中添加或修改相关配置参数来开启通用查询日志,而针对性地查看特定类型的错误日志,则需要依据错误日志的功能分类,使用像SHOW VARIABLES LIKE 'log_error';
这样的命令,或是特定的日志分析工具来实现。
原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/1078155.html
本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。
发表回复